About Ahlem Guesmi
Ahlem Guesmi is a scholar working on Water Science and Technology, Electronic, Optical and Magnetic Materials and Inorganic Chemistry, having authored 127 papers that have together received 1.4k indexed citations. Recurring topics across this work include Adsorption and biosorption for pollutant removal (19 papers), Dyeing and Modifying Textile Fibers (15 papers) and Liquid Crystal Research Advancements (14 papers). The work is most often cited by research in Building and Construction (508 citations), Water Science and Technology (215 citations) and Inorganic Chemistry (210 citations). Ahlem Guesmi has collaborated with scholars based in Saudi Arabia, Tunisia and France. Frequent co-authors include Naoufel Ben Hamadi, Faouzi Sakli, N. Ladhari, Manel Ben Ticha, Wafa Haddar, Lotfi Khezami, Wesam Abd El‐Fattah, Nizar Meksi, Aymen Amine Assadi and Ahmed Shahat.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and Scientific Reports.
